28 #include <getopt.h>
29 #include <stdio.h>
30 #include <string.h>
31 #include "xf86drm.h"
32 #include "libkms.h"
33 
34 #include "util/kms.h"
35 
36 #define CHECK_RET_RETURN(ret, str) \
37 	if (ret < 0) { \
38 		printf("%s: %s (%s)\n", __func__, str, strerror(-ret)); \
39 		return ret; \
40 	}
41 
test_bo(struct kms_driver * kms)42 static int test_bo(struct kms_driver *kms)
43 {
44 	struct kms_bo *bo;
45 	int ret;
46 	unsigned attrs[7] = {
47 		KMS_WIDTH, 1024,
48 		KMS_HEIGHT, 768,
49 		KMS_BO_TYPE, KMS_BO_TYPE_SCANOUT_X8R8G8B8,
50 		KMS_TERMINATE_PROP_LIST,
51 	};
52 
53 	ret = kms_bo_create(kms, attrs, &bo);
54 	CHECK_RET_RETURN(ret, "Could not create bo");
55 
56 	kms_bo_destroy(&bo);
57 
58 	return 0;
59 }
60 
usage(const char * program)61 static void usage(const char *program)
62 {
63 	fprintf(stderr, "Usage: %s [options]\n", program);
64 	fprintf(stderr, "\n");
65 	fprintf(stderr, "  -D DEVICE  open the given device\n");
66 	fprintf(stderr, "  -M MODULE  open the given module\n");
67 }
68 
main(int argc,char ** argv)69 int main(int argc, char** argv)
70 {
71 	static const char optstr[] = "D:M:";
72 	struct kms_driver *kms;
73 	int c, fd, ret;
74 	char *device = NULL;
75 	char *module = NULL;
76 
77 	while ((c = getopt(argc, argv, optstr)) != -1) {
78 		switch (c) {
79 		case 'D':
80 			device = optarg;
81 			break;
82 		case 'M':
83 			module = optarg;
84 			break;
85 		default:
86 			usage(argv[0]);
87 			return 0;
88 		}
89 	}
90 
91 	fd = util_open(device, module);
92 	CHECK_RET_RETURN(fd, "Could not open device");
93 
94 	ret = kms_create(fd, &kms);
95 	CHECK_RET_RETURN(ret, "Failed to create kms driver");
96 
97 	ret = test_bo(kms);
98 	if (ret)
99 		goto err;
100 
101 	printf("%s: All ok!\n", __func__);
102 
103 	kms_destroy(&kms);
104 	return 0;
105 
106 err:
107 	kms_destroy(&kms);
108 	return ret;
109 }
